2013 ds no start
« on: November 13, 2019, 06:31:29 AM »

Fully charged but when I bring up the kickstand it won't go. Still flashes like kill switch is engaged. I have turned on/off multiple times, kickstand up/down, flicked kill switch, tried sport/eco modes, moved bike back and forth, applied brakes.....I'm running out of ideas.

It did this a week ago right after I took it off charger but when I came back later it was fine. Chargers great so I'm at a loss.

Heeelllppp

Re: 2013 ds no start
« Reply #1 on: November 13, 2019, 06:37:20 AM »

Use the mobile app to get the logs, and email them to yourself, then upload them for a text output:
https://home.hasslers.net/zerologparser/log_parser.php

The logs should tell you what the MBB is thinking.

(For those who don't know, the 2013 dash doesn't show error codes. Also it doesn't have the Calex charger.)

Re: 2013 ds no start
« Reply #7 on: November 14, 2019, 06:10:04 AM »

> Doesn't the sidestand switch use light? If that's the case, perhaps the sidestand only needs cleaning where the light is detected.

It's magnetic.  There's a magnet in the stand, and hall effect or reed switch wired up.  See the wiring diagrams as well:

https://zeromanual.com/wiki/Unofficial_Service_Manual#Schematic

Re: 2013 ds no start
« Reply #10 on: November 20, 2019, 04:54:28 AM »

I don't have a bike I can go check for this, but basically the magnet needs to go into a little recessed hole on the inside facing the frame/swingarm pivot area. You'll see the sensor face outward.

https://zeromanual.com/wiki/Unofficial_Service_Manual#Kickstand_Switch
